Brief Announcement: Space Bounds for Reliable Multi-Writer Data Store

Reliable storage emulations from fault-prone components have established them- selves as an algorithmic foundation of modern storage services and applications. Most existing reliable storage emulations are built from storage services sup- porting custom-built read-modify-write (RMW) primitives (e.g., [2]). Since such primitives are not typically available with pre-existing or off-the-shelf components (such as cloud storage services or network-attached disks), it is natural to ask if they are indeed essential for effcient storage emulations.
In this paper, we answer this question in the armative.
